What does the output of the fit function provide for the predict function?

The output of the fit function provides statistical forecast parameters, which are crucial for the predict function to generate forecasts. When the fit function processes the input data, it identifies patterns and relationships within the data and establishes statistical parameters that define these relationships. These parameters may include coefficients, intercepts, and error metrics, which inform the predictive model about how to interpret new data for forecasting.

In essence, the fit function calibrates the model, enabling the predict function to apply these established statistical relationships to generate accurate forecasts based on new input data. This is a foundational concept in statistical modeling and machine learning, where fitting the model to existing data allows it to make reliable predictions about future outcomes.
